We live in the country and have plenty of land for ducks, chickens, etc. The people that live across the road don't seem to take any responsibility for the animals they breed. There are constantly breeding new chickens, ducks, puppies and kittens running all over the area and they seem to be coming from their house. I had six Swedish blue ducks roaming around the area freely and they didnt seem to be cared for, fed, given water, etc. They were always bedding down in my front yard or in my bushes. I felt bad for them because we were going to a heat wave so, I put out a kiddie pool in the shade. I also put out food and drinking water every day. The ducks pretty much lived in that pool all day. After a couple weeks, I got an alert on my security cams and some wild dogs killed five of them in the middle of the night. I found the one lone survivor at sun up and got her in to my fenced off property in the back of house. I provided everything she needed, a pool, food, fresh water, lots of clean straw and shelter. I could only find four Muscovies to keep her company in the mean time. I have since got two more female mallards and they are doing great!
